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 915562 Details for
Bug 947253
media-video/ffmpeg: fix verify-sig on prefix systems (patch)
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
[patch]
0001-media-video-ffmpeg-fix-verify-sig-on-prefix-systems.patch
0001-media-video-ffmpeg-fix-verify-sig-on-prefix-systems.patch (text/plain), 4.91 KB, created by
jlucas
on 2024-12-31 00:40:58 UTC
(
hide
)
Description:
0001-media-video-ffmpeg-fix-verify-sig-on-prefix-systems.patch
Filename:
MIME Type:
Creator:
jlucas
Created:
2024-12-31 00:40:58 UTC
Size:
4.91 KB
patch
obsolete
>From cabc2a3bffe04535d2022bfdda15643a120bce63 Mon Sep 17 00:00:00 2001 >From: =?UTF-8?q?Jo=C3=A3o=20Lucas?= <jlucas@disroot.org> >Date: Mon, 30 Dec 2024 23:39:50 +0000 >Subject: [PATCH] media-video/ffmpeg: fix verify-sig on prefix systems >MIME-Version: 1.0 >Content-Type: text/plain; charset=UTF-8 >Content-Transfer-Encoding: 8bit > >Specify PGP key path in VERIFY_SIG_OPENPGP_KEY_PATH env variable instead >of passing as an argument to verify-sig_verify_detached, since the >latter does not prepend the prefix to the path. > >Signed-off-by: João Lucas <jlucas@disroot.org> >--- > media-video/ffmpeg/ffmpeg-6.1.1-r8.ebuild | 4 ++-- > media-video/ffmpeg/ffmpeg-6.1.2.ebuild | 4 ++-- > media-video/ffmpeg/ffmpeg-7.0.1-r1.ebuild | 4 ++-- > media-video/ffmpeg/ffmpeg-7.0.2-r1.ebuild | 4 ++-- > media-video/ffmpeg/ffmpeg-9999.ebuild | 4 ++-- > 5 files changed, 10 insertions(+), 10 deletions(-) > >diff --git a/media-video/ffmpeg/ffmpeg-6.1.1-r8.ebuild b/media-video/ffmpeg/ffmpeg-6.1.1-r8.ebuild >index a2ffb7f3e2..b79d92995f 100644 >--- a/media-video/ffmpeg/ffmpeg-6.1.1-r8.ebuild >+++ b/media-video/ffmpeg/ffmpeg-6.1.1-r8.ebuild >@@ -52,8 +52,8 @@ else # Release > > src_unpack() { > if use verify-sig; then >- verify-sig_verify_detached "${DISTDIR}"/${P/_/-}.tar.xz{,.asc} /usr/share/openpgp-keys/ffmpeg.asc >- use soc && verify-sig_verify_detached "${DISTDIR}"/${SOC_PATCH}{,.asc} /usr/share/openpgp-keys/gentoo-developers.asc >+ VERIFY_SIG_OPENPGP_KEY_PATH=/usr/share/openpgp-keys/ffmpeg.asc verify-sig_verify_detached "${DISTDIR}"/${P/_/-}.tar.xz{,.asc} >+ use soc && VERIFY_SIG_OPENPGP_KEY_PATH=/usr/share/openpgp-keys/gentoo-developers.asc verify-sig_verify_detached "${DISTDIR}"/${SOC_PATCH}{,.asc} > fi > default > } >diff --git a/media-video/ffmpeg/ffmpeg-6.1.2.ebuild b/media-video/ffmpeg/ffmpeg-6.1.2.ebuild >index cc483e695f..2a5017a1ff 100644 >--- a/media-video/ffmpeg/ffmpeg-6.1.2.ebuild >+++ b/media-video/ffmpeg/ffmpeg-6.1.2.ebuild >@@ -52,8 +52,8 @@ else # Release > > src_unpack() { > if use verify-sig; then >- verify-sig_verify_detached "${DISTDIR}"/${P/_/-}.tar.xz{,.asc} /usr/share/openpgp-keys/ffmpeg.asc >- use soc && verify-sig_verify_detached "${DISTDIR}"/${SOC_PATCH}{,.asc} /usr/share/openpgp-keys/gentoo-developers.asc >+ VERIFY_SIG_OPENPGP_KEY_PATH=/usr/share/openpgp-keys/ffmpeg.asc verify-sig_verify_detached "${DISTDIR}"/${P/_/-}.tar.xz{,.asc} >+ use soc && VERIFY_SIG_OPENPGP_KEY_PATH=/usr/share/openpgp-keys/gentoo-developers.asc verify-sig_verify_detached "${DISTDIR}"/${SOC_PATCH}{,.asc} > fi > default > } >diff --git a/media-video/ffmpeg/ffmpeg-7.0.1-r1.ebuild b/media-video/ffmpeg/ffmpeg-7.0.1-r1.ebuild >index aa31d2b98e..86fd94b92e 100644 >--- a/media-video/ffmpeg/ffmpeg-7.0.1-r1.ebuild >+++ b/media-video/ffmpeg/ffmpeg-7.0.1-r1.ebuild >@@ -52,8 +52,8 @@ else # Release > > src_unpack() { > if use verify-sig; then >- verify-sig_verify_detached "${DISTDIR}"/${P/_/-}.tar.xz{,.asc} /usr/share/openpgp-keys/ffmpeg.asc >- use soc && verify-sig_verify_detached "${DISTDIR}"/${SOC_PATCH}{,.asc} /usr/share/openpgp-keys/gentoo-developers.asc >+ VERIFY_SIG_OPENPGP_KEY_PATH=/usr/share/openpgp-keys/ffmpeg.asc verify-sig_verify_detached "${DISTDIR}"/${P/_/-}.tar.xz{,.asc} >+ use soc && VERIFY_SIG_OPENPGP_KEY_PATH=/usr/share/openpgp-keys/gentoo-developers.asc verify-sig_verify_detached "${DISTDIR}"/${SOC_PATCH}{,.asc} > fi > default > } >diff --git a/media-video/ffmpeg/ffmpeg-7.0.2-r1.ebuild b/media-video/ffmpeg/ffmpeg-7.0.2-r1.ebuild >index aa31d2b98e..86fd94b92e 100644 >--- a/media-video/ffmpeg/ffmpeg-7.0.2-r1.ebuild >+++ b/media-video/ffmpeg/ffmpeg-7.0.2-r1.ebuild >@@ -52,8 +52,8 @@ else # Release > > src_unpack() { > if use verify-sig; then >- verify-sig_verify_detached "${DISTDIR}"/${P/_/-}.tar.xz{,.asc} /usr/share/openpgp-keys/ffmpeg.asc >- use soc && verify-sig_verify_detached "${DISTDIR}"/${SOC_PATCH}{,.asc} /usr/share/openpgp-keys/gentoo-developers.asc >+ VERIFY_SIG_OPENPGP_KEY_PATH=/usr/share/openpgp-keys/ffmpeg.asc verify-sig_verify_detached "${DISTDIR}"/${P/_/-}.tar.xz{,.asc} >+ use soc && VERIFY_SIG_OPENPGP_KEY_PATH=/usr/share/openpgp-keys/gentoo-developers.asc verify-sig_verify_detached "${DISTDIR}"/${SOC_PATCH}{,.asc} > fi > default > } >diff --git a/media-video/ffmpeg/ffmpeg-9999.ebuild b/media-video/ffmpeg/ffmpeg-9999.ebuild >index 3fd22d65a0..bc61763dde 100644 >--- a/media-video/ffmpeg/ffmpeg-9999.ebuild >+++ b/media-video/ffmpeg/ffmpeg-9999.ebuild >@@ -52,8 +52,8 @@ else # Release > > src_unpack() { > if use verify-sig; then >- verify-sig_verify_detached "${DISTDIR}"/${P/_/-}.tar.xz{,.asc} /usr/share/openpgp-keys/ffmpeg.asc >- use soc && verify-sig_verify_detached "${DISTDIR}"/${SOC_PATCH}{,.asc} /usr/share/openpgp-keys/gentoo-developers.asc >+ VERIFY_SIG_OPENPGP_KEY_PATH=/usr/share/openpgp-keys/ffmpeg.asc verify-sig_verify_detached "${DISTDIR}"/${P/_/-}.tar.xz{,.asc} >+ use soc && VERIFY_SIG_OPENPGP_KEY_PATH=/usr/share/openpgp-keys/gentoo-developers.asc verify-sig_verify_detached "${DISTDIR}"/${SOC_PATCH}{,.asc} > fi > default > } >-- >2.47.1 >
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 947253
: 915562